Essential Components and Design Features

Advanced Compression Technology

The candy tablet press machine's core functionality revolves around its advanced compression technology, which ensures precise and uniform tablet formation. The ZP226-17D model exemplifies this with its 17-station design, accommodating tablets up to 20mm in diameter and 6mm in thickness. This sophisticated system incorporates multiple compression stages, utilizing precisely calibrated pressure distribution to achieve optimal tablet density and hardness. The machine's robust construction, weighing 1000kg, provides the stability necessary for maintaining consistent compression forces throughout extended production runs.

Precision Control Systems

Modern candy tablet press machines incorporate state-of-the-art control systems that monitor and adjust various parameters in real-time. These systems regulate factors such as compression force, tablet weight, and production speed, ensuring consistent quality across batches. The integrated touch-screen interface provides operators with comprehensive control over production parameters, while advanced sensors continuously monitor tablet weight and hardness. This level of precision control enables the machine to maintain its impressive production capacity of 34,200 pieces per hour while ensuring each tablet meets exact specifications.

Material Feed Mechanisms

The efficiency of the candy tablet press machine heavily depends on its material feed system. Advanced feed mechanisms ensure consistent powder flow and precise filling of die cavities. This system incorporates forced feeders with adjustable speed controls, allowing operators to optimize powder distribution based on material characteristics. The design includes anti-bridging features to prevent powder compaction and ensure smooth material flow, while specialized coating treatments on contact surfaces minimize material adhesion and reduce waste.

Performance Optimization Features

Production Speed Enhancement

High-speed production capabilities represent a crucial feature of modern candy tablet press machines. The equipment's sophisticated design enables rapid turnaround times while maintaining product quality. Advanced servo motor systems and precision-engineered components work in harmony to achieve optimal production rates. The machine's 17-station configuration allows for efficient tablet formation, with each station precisely timed to maximize output while preventing tablet defects.

Quality Control Integration

Quality control features are seamlessly integrated into the candy tablet press machine's operation. Continuous monitoring systems track critical parameters throughout the production process, ensuring consistency in tablet weight, thickness, and hardness. The machine incorporates advanced rejection mechanisms that automatically remove substandard tablets without interrupting production flow. Real-time data collection and analysis capabilities enable operators to identify and address potential issues before they affect product quality.

Maintenance Optimization

The candy tablet press machine's design prioritizes ease of maintenance and cleaning. Quick-release mechanisms facilitate rapid tooling changes and cleaning procedures, minimizing production downtime. The machine's construction includes easily accessible components and modular design elements that simplify maintenance tasks. Regular maintenance schedules are supported by built-in diagnostic systems that alert operators to potential issues before they become critical.

Safety and Compliance Features

Operator Safety Systems

The candy tablet press machine incorporates comprehensive safety features that extend beyond basic operational safeguards. Advanced sensor systems continuously monitor machine operations, automatically detecting and responding to potential hazards. The equipment features sophisticated pressure-sensitive safety barriers that instantly halt operations if breached, protecting operators from moving components. Emergency shutdown protocols are integrated throughout the system, with strategically placed emergency stop buttons ensuring immediate access from any position around the machine. The control interface includes clear visual indicators and warning systems that alert operators to any safety-related issues, while automated safety checks prevent machine startup unless all protective measures are properly engaged.

Environmental Control Measures

The candy tablet press machine features an advanced environmental control system that maintains optimal production conditions. Integrated humidity sensors work in conjunction with climate control systems to prevent moisture-related issues that could affect product quality. The machine's sealed processing chamber incorporates HEPA filtration technology, ensuring a clean operating environment while minimizing cross-contamination risks. A sophisticated dust extraction system captures and contains airborne particles, protecting both product integrity and operator health. Temperature monitoring systems maintain consistent conditions throughout the production process, while automated ventilation adjusts airflow patterns to optimize processing conditions and energy efficiency.

Regulatory Compliance

The candy tablet press machine meets rigorous international regulatory standards through its innovative design and construction. The equipment's GMP-compliant features include validated cleaning processes and documentation systems that ensure consistent compliance with regulatory requirements. All product-contact surfaces are manufactured from FDA-approved materials, with surface finishes meeting stringent pharmaceutical-grade specifications. The machine's control system maintains detailed electronic batch records, facilitating regulatory audits and quality assurance processes. Comprehensive validation documentation supports qualification requirements, while built-in quality control measures ensure consistent compliance with pharmaceutical manufacturing standards.
